About L.S. JENSEN

L.S. JENSEN is a scholar working on Animal Science and Zoology, Plant Science, Nutrition and Dietetics, Biochemistry and Food Science, having authored 137 papers that have together received 2.5k indexed citations. Recurring topics across this work include Animal Nutrition and Physiology (118 papers), Rabbits: Nutrition, Reproduction, Health (25 papers), Livestock and Poultry Management (20 papers), Antioxidant Activity and Oxidative Stress (14 papers), Meat and Animal Product Quality (14 papers), Selenium in Biological Systems (11 papers), Moringa oleifera research and applications (10 papers) and Coccidia and coccidiosis research (9 papers). The work is most often cited by research in Animal Science and Zoology (1.9k citations), Biochemistry (254 citations), Aquatic Science (284 citations), Nutrition and Dietetics (409 citations) and Small Animals (125 citations). L.S. JENSEN has collaborated with scholars based in United States, Denmark and Egypt. Frequent co-authors include D.V. MAURICE, James McGinnis, Y. Pinchasov, J.R. VELTMANN, Cássio Xavier de Mendonça, P. L. Long, Yukio Akiba, J.D. Latshaw, I. Bartov and M.S. Lilburn. Their work appears in journals such as Poultry Science, Journal of Nutrition, Experimental Biology and Medicine, Avian Diseases and British Poultry Science.
